Deep Groove Ball Bearing Applications A Comprehensive Overview
Deep groove ball bearings are one of the most widely used types of bearings in various industries due to their versatility, reliability, and ability to accommodate both radial and axial loads. These bearings feature a simple design with an inner and outer ring, balls, and a cage that holds the balls in place. Their construction allows for smooth operation, making them an ideal choice for many applications.
One of the primary applications of deep groove ball bearings is in electric motors. Electric motors require precision and smooth movement to operate efficiently, and deep groove ball bearings provide the necessary support to minimize friction and wear. Their ability to handle both radial and axial loads enables these bearings to maintain balance while facilitating high-speed rotations.
In the automotive industry, deep groove ball bearings are extensively used in various components, including the wheels, transmissions, and engines. In wheel applications, they help reduce rolling resistance, improving fuel efficiency. Additionally, in transmissions, these bearings contribute to smoother gear shifts by managing the loads that occur during operation. Their robustness and durability make them well-suited for the demanding conditions found within automotive environments.
Another significant area of application is in industrial machinery. Deep groove ball bearings can be found in conveyors, pumps, fans, and other equipment where precision motion is crucial. Their ability to operate at high speeds with low noise levels makes them ideal for machinery that requires continuous operation. Moreover, these bearings can endure adverse conditions, such as exposure to dust, moisture, and extreme temperatures, ensuring long-term reliability.
In the consumer electronics sector, devices such as hard drives and washing machines incorporate deep groove ball bearings to enhance performance and extend their lifespan. By enabling smooth rotation and reducing vibration, these bearings play a critical role in the functionality of everyday appliances. Their compact size and design allow for easy integration into various electronic devices.
Additionally, deep groove ball bearings are utilized in the aerospace industry. They are critical in aircraft engines, landing gear, and other flight systems where safety and reliability are paramount. The bearings must withstand extreme conditions, including high speeds and varying loads, making their selection and maintenance crucial.
